INSTRUCTIONS FOR PLACING INTERLIBRARY LOAN REQUESTS ONLINE

To Login:

Go to LoanShark
The Library should say: b1ib

Your username is your first and last name as one word.

Your password is userpass for your first log-in.  It will prompt you to change your password then.  Please change it to something memorable for you.

Once you have logged in, you can search for your item(s).  When you find what you want, click on the title link and a new screen will pop up.  You will see on the top right hand corner.  Click on this and another screen will pop up already filled in with your information.  Review for accuracy.  The Main Library is already filled in, but if you would like to receive your book at a branch, click the pull down menu and select the appropriate branch.  Then click submit.   If you don't see your item, you can create a request by clicking on Blank Request Form.  Please try to include as much information as possible, including Author name, Title, Publisher, Date, and ISBN.  If ordering copies from a journal or magazine or microfilm, please include how much you are willing to pay for these copies, otherwise the request will not get filled.

By clicking on Patron Menu, you can track your requests.

 

Requests are not guaranteed and are subject to the lending library's discretion.
